MySQL-Admin: 一站式MySQL/MariaDB数据库管理解决方案
需积分: 9 9 浏览量
更新于2024-12-07
收藏 21KB ZIP 举报
资源摘要信息:"MySQL-Admin是一个命令行工具,用于管理和维护MySQL以及MariaDB数据库系统。该工具能够执行多种数据库操作,包括但不限于创建、删除、导入和导出数据库,创建和删除用户,以及为用户设置新密码。此外,MySQL-Admin支持导入大量数据到数据库中,自动续订AUTO_INCREMENT字段,清空表格内容,并提供自动选择查询的功能。用户还可以执行自己的SQL查询来完成特定任务。"
MySQL-Admin是一个专门针对MySQL和MariaDB数据库管理而设计的开源工具,它通过命令行界面提供了一系列的功能,使得数据库的日常管理工作变得更加高效和方便。
1. 数据库操作
- 创建/删除数据库:可以使用MySQL-Admin创建新的数据库,或者删除不再需要的数据库,这对于数据库的生命周期管理是必不可少的。
- 导入/导出数据库:MySQL-Admin允许用户导入或导出数据库的数据和结构,这对于迁移、备份和灾难恢复等场景尤其重要。
- 插入大量信息:用户可以将大量数据一次性插入数据库,这在初始化数据库或者进行大规模数据填充时非常有用。
2. 用户管理
- 创建/删除用户:可以创建新的数据库用户或删除现有用户,这对于数据库的安全性和访问控制至关重要。
- 修改密码:MySQL-Admin提供了一个便捷的方式为用户设置或修改密码,有助于加强数据库账户的安全性。
3. 数据维护
- 续订AUTO_INCREMENT栏:当数据库表使用AUTO_INCREMENT属性的字段时,MySQL-Admin可以帮助自动维护这一字段的值,确保数据的连续性。
- 删除表格内容:可以清空整个表格的内容,这在进行数据清理或者测试时非常有用。
4. 查询执行
- 自动选择查询:该工具能够自动执行预设的查询,这可能是在处理常见任务时减少重复工作的有效方式。
- 使用自定义SQL查询:用户可以手动输入SQL语句来执行复杂的数据库操作,使得MySQL-Admin更加灵活和强大。
5. 安装和配置
- 安装:MySQL-Admin的安装过程非常简单,只需要克隆对应的Git存储库,并运行配置脚本。
- 配置:安装后,用户可以通过配置脚本来设置MySQL-Admin的工作环境,确保它能够正确连接到MySQL或MariaDB服务器。
6. 特别注意
- 数据插入文件:如果需要使用数据插入工具,需要将数据准备好并保存在指定的文件中。需要注意的是,无需包含AUTO_INCREMENT值。
- 安全性:在处理包含密码等敏感信息的文件时,应使用chmod 600命令来确保文件的安全性,防止未授权访问。
通过提供这些功能,MySQL-Admin极大地简化了数据库的日常管理任务,并提高了运维人员的工作效率。尽管它主要是通过命令行界面进行操作,但其简洁的设计和强大的功能使得它成为许多数据库管理员的有力工具。对于使用Shell脚本自动化和优化数据库操作流程的用户来说,MySQL-Admin是一个值得尝试的工具。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2021-03-11 上传
2021-05-15 上传
2021-05-22 上传
2021-05-11 上传
2021-01-31 上传
2021-02-18 上传
是十五呀
- 粉丝: 33
- 资源: 4634
最新资源
- Cucumber-JVM模板项目快速入门教程
- ECharts打造公司组织架构可视化展示
- DC Water Alerts 数据开放平台介绍
- 图形化编程打造智能家居控制系统
- 个人网站构建:使用CSS实现风格化布局
- 使用CANBUS控制LED灯柱颜色的Matlab代码实现
- ACTCMS管理系统安装与更新教程
- 快速查看IP地址及地理位置信息的View My IP插件
- Pandas库助力数据分析与编程效率提升
- Python实现k均值聚类音乐数据可视化分析
- formdotcom打造高效网络表单解决方案
- 仿京东套餐购买列表源码DYCPackage解析
- 开源管理工具orgParty:面向PartySur的多功能应用程序
- Flutter时间跟踪应用Time_tracker入门教程
- AngularJS实现自定义滑动项目及动作指南
- 掌握C++编译时打印:compile-time-printer的使用与原理